I made a matching set.....crop-top and knickers.....


Sage is the gorgeous model today :)  I've made the underwear from cotton lycra that's been in my stash for a long time. I made all my grandbabies nighties from this stuff before they were born....the eldest is nearly 14!!  It's the BEST fabric for babies as it's very soft, sturdy and stretchy....in a word COMFY! I'm sure "The Girls" will enjoy wearing it too :)

The edges have been finished with fold-over elastic from my Etsy buy. This stuff is brilliant!! I had to fiddle with the knicker pattern a bit to get them to fit how I liked, but got there in the end. There are a couple of pairs of trial runs that will be okay to use too. I made a pair with lingerie elastic, with a little picot edge, and that works great also, so I might also make a crop-top with that trim when I get around to it.

I haven't photo'd the back view but I've closed the top with velcro. I couldn't find any closures that I liked, that were small enough and the GDs real life crop-tops don't have any closures, they are pull-on....not practical for the dolls....so velcro it is!
